The demand for nurses is rising rapidly due to an aging population, increasing rates of chronic illnesses, and expanded healthcare access. Consequently, hospitals and clinics often struggle to maintain adequate staff levels, which can affect patient care quality. Nursing staffing agencies help mitigate these issues by providing access to a pool of skilled nurses who are ready to step in when needed. This flexibility is crucial, especially during peak times or unexpected absences.
One of the significant advantages of using a nursing staffing agency is the ability to quickly fill vacancies with qualified personnel. These agencies conduct thorough screenings and verifications to ensure that their nurses possess the necessary credentials and experience. This vetting process saves healthcare facilities time and resources that would otherwise be spent on recruitment and training. Furthermore, agencies often provide continuing education opportunities for their nurses, ensuring that they remain up-to-date with the latest medical practices and technologies.
Another benefit is the variety of employment arrangements available through nursing staffing agencies. Nurses can find temporary, part-time, or full-time positions that fit their personal schedules and career goals. This flexibility can lead to improved job satisfaction and reduced burnout, which is particularly important in such a demanding profession. For healthcare facilities, having access to a diverse range of staffing options allows them to adapt to changing needs without the long-term commitment required by traditional hiring methods.
